Solved Apparently, while the board was mounted in the case, I wasn't able to apply enough force to get the RAM to "click" into place despite the ejector tabs (softly) moving into the lock position. Removing the board and inserting the sticks while pressing from the back did the trick. A satisfying "click" and it started up properly and displayed the BIOS. I tested all 4 slots individually and they work properly. Original post:
